OLIVER, Harold Wilfred
Service Number: | 18242 |
---|---|
Enlisted: | 26 February 1917, Adelaide, South Australia |
Last Rank: | Private |
Last Unit: | 3rd Australian General Hospital - WW1 |
Born: | Glenelg, South Australia, 4 December 1894 |
Home Town: | Glenelg, Holdfast Bay, South Australia |
Schooling: | Not yet discovered |
Occupation: | Carpenter |
Died: | Natural causes, Adelaide, South Australia, 19 November 1947, aged 52 years |
Cemetery: |
Centennial Park Cemetery, South Australia General C, Path 16, Grave 1226. Interred on 20 November 1947 |
Memorials: | Glenelg Moseley Street Uniting Church "Heroes of Two World Wars" |

Add my storyBiography contributed by Carol Foster
Son of Richard Oliver and Phillippa Oliver nee Scorse of Ramsgate Street, Glenelg, SA.
Commenced return to Australia on 17 August 1919 aboard HT Kanowna disembarking on 26 October 1919 at Sydney for onward travel to Adelaide
Medals: British War Medal, Victory Medal
On 4 December 1920 Harold married Doris Muriel Foreman at th residence of Mr. Foreman of Goodwood, SA
